What are the most popular physical Bitcoin providers?

When it comes to investing in Bitcoin, many individuals prefer the option of acquiring physical Bitcoin, also known as Bitcoin tokens or coins. These tangible representations of digital currency often serve as a novelty item or a collector's piece, while also functioning as a store of value. However, with the plethora of providers out there, it begs the question: which are the most popular physical Bitcoin providers? Some might argue that Casascius coins, first introduced in 2011, are among the most sought-after, given their limited edition and unique serial numbers. Others may point to Bitcoin Paper Wallets, which offer a more DIY approach to securing your digital assets. Additionally, companies like Denarium and Bitbill offer physical Bitcoin coins with varying denominations and designs. Ultimately, the choice of a physical Bitcoin provider depends on personal preference, security considerations, and the availability of the products.
